The image depicts a scene of extensive urban destruction in Joubar Municipality, Syria, under an overcast sky. The foreground features a low concrete barrier with "ساحة الشهداء" (Martyrs' Square) spray-painted in black on its visible left surface. Beyond this barrier, the ground is covered in demolition debris, concrete fragments, and twisted rebar.

Dominating the midground is a multi-story building, approximately five to six stories tall, with severe structural damage. Its light-colored tiled facade is heavily compromised, revealing exposed concrete and internal structural elements. Numerous window openings are empty, lacking glass or frames, and several walls exhibit perforations consistent with bullet impacts or shrapnel. The upper stories are significantly damaged, with large sections of the facade missing and interiors exposed. To the left, a second, similarly damaged residential-style building with multiple missing windowpanes is visible.

Between the buildings, an open ground-level area is filled with rubble. A small, green deciduous sapling grows directly from the debris. Partially obscured behind this sapling is a white sedan with its driver's side door open, facing away from the viewer. In the distant background, through the open spaces of the damaged structures, a vertical, slender structure resembling a minaret is visible against the muted sky, indicating the presence of other damaged or intact buildings further away. No individuals are present in the scene.
